VLOOKUP 함수를 활용한 반복 업무 자동화
VLOOKUP 함수 활용하기: 반복적인 SEO 작업 자동화하기
반복적이고 지루한 SEO 작업은 시간 낭비가 될 수 있습니다. 하지만 VLOOKUP 함수를 활용하면 이러한 작업을 자동화하여 시간을 절약하고 생산성을 높일 수 있습니다. 이 블로그 글에서는 VLOOKUP 함수의 기본 사항과 이를 활용하여 일반적인 SEO 작업을 자동화하는 방법을 안내해 드리겠습니다.
VLOOKUP 함수를 활용한 반복 업무 자동화
🖊️ 글의 주요 내용을 목차로 요약해 봤어요 |
---|
VLOOKUP의 기본 원리 파악 |
다중 열의 일치를 위한 INDEX 및 MATCH 함수와의 결합 |
조인 연산을 통한 서로 다른 테이블 합병 |
Power Query를 활용한 고급 데이터 변환 자동화 |
VLOOKUP을 통한 대규모 데이터세트 처리 최적화 |
VLOOKUP의 기본 원리 파악
VLOOKUP 함수는 Microsoft Excel에서 가장 흔히 사용되는 함수 중 하나로, 대규모 데이터셋에서 원하는 값을 빠르고 쉽게 검색하는 데 사용됩니다. 이 함수는 두 가지 매개 변수, 즉 검색 키와 검색 범위를 요구합니다. 검색 키는 찾고 있는 값을 포함하는 셀의 참조이며, 검색 범위는 VLOOKUP가 값을 검색할 데이터가 포함된 표입니다.
또한 VLOOKUP 함수에는 선택적 매개 변수인 열 인덱스 인수가 있습니다. 이 인수를 지정하면 함수는 검색 범위에서 검색 키와 일치하는 값이 포함된 열을 나타냅니다. 열 인덱스 인수를 사용하지 않으면 VLOOKUP는 검색 범위의 가장 왼쪽 열을 검색합니다.
예를 들어, "제품" 열에 "애플"이 있는 행에서 "가격" 값을 찾고 싶은 경우 다음과 같은 VLOOKUP 함수를 사용할 수 있습니다.
=VLOOKUP("애플", A1:B10, 2, FALSE)
이 함수에서 검색 키는 "애플", 검색 범위는 A1:B10 셀 범위, 열 인덱스 인수는 2입니다. 이는 VLOOKUP가 검색 범위의 두 번째 열(B)에서 "애플" 값과 일치하는 값을 검색하도록 합니다. FALSE 매개 변수는 대소문자를 구분하는 검색을 지정합니다.
다중 열의 일치를 위한 INDEX 및 MATCH 함수와의 결합
VLOOKUP 함수가 한 열의 데이터만 일치시킬 수 있는 반면, INDEX 및 MATCH 함수를 결합하면 **다중 열의 데이터 일치**가 가능해집니다. 이를 통해 보다 구체적인 검색 및 데이터 검색이 가능해집니다.
함수 | 설명 | ||
---|---|---|---|
INDEX | 주어진 행 및 열 번호에 위치한 데이터를 반환 | ||
MATCH | 지정된 배열에서 주어진 값이 매치되는 첫 번째 위치를 반환 | ||
다음 표는 INDEX 및 MATCH 함수를 VLOOKUP 함수와 결합하는 방법을 보여줍니다. | |||
조건 | MATCH 함수 | INDEX 함수 | VLOOKUP 함수 |
한 열의 일치 | BOOLEAN 매칭(TRUE/FALSE) | 일치한 행의 위치 | 전체 행 반환 |
다중 열의 일치 | 근사 매칭(가장 가까운 일치) | 일치한 값의 열 번호 반환 | 특정 열의 값 반환 |
예제: | |||
다음 데이터와 함께 있는 매출 데이터베이스에서 특정 날짜와 지역의 매출을 찾으려면 다음과 같은 함수를 사용할 수 있습니다. | |||
``` | |||
=VLOOKUP(A2,INDEX(MATCH({A2,B2},{"날짜","지역"},0),{1,2}),3,FALSE) | |||
``` | |||
여기서, | |||
* INDEX 함수는 매치되는 날짜와 지역의 행 번호를 반환합니다. | |||
* MATCH 함수는 날짜와 지역이 데이터베이스에 있는 두 열에서 매치되는 첫 번째 위치를 찾습니다. | |||
* VLOOKUP 함수는 일치한 행의 세 번째 열(매출)을 반환합니다. |
조인 연산을 통한 서로 다른 테이블 합병
Q: 서로 다른 테이블에 존재하는 데이터를 어떻게 결합할 수 있나요?
A: 조인 연산을 사용하세요. 조인 연산은 공통 키를 기준으로 두 개 이상의 테이블을 결합하는 데이터베이스 작업입니다.
Q: 어떤 유형의 조인 연산이 있나요?
A: 자주 사용되는 조인 연산 유형은 다음과 같습니다. * 내부 조인(INNER JOIN): 두 테이블의 모든 매칭 행을 반환합니다. * 외부 조인(OUTER JOIN): 매칭 행과 매칭되지 않은 행을 모두 반환합니다. * 왼쪽 외부 조인(LEFT OUTER JOIN): 왼쪽 테이블의 모든 행과 매칭되지 않으면 Null 값을 반환하는 오른쪽 테이블의 행을 반환합니다. * 오른쪽 외부 조인(RIGHT OUTER JOIN): 오른쪽 테이블의 모든 행과 매칭되지 않으면 Null 값을 반환하는 왼쪽 테이블의 행을 반환합니다. * 전체 외부 조인(FULL OUTER JOIN): 두 테이블의 모든 행과 매칭되지 않으면 Null 값을 반환하는 행을 반환합니다.
Q: 조인 연산을 VLOOKUP 함수와 어떻게 결합할 수 있나요?
A: VLOOKUP 함수의 참고 테이블로 서로 다른 테이블에서 조인한 결과를 사용할 수 있습니다. 그러면 VLOOKUP 함수에서 공통 키를 찾아 매칭된 데이터를 페어링할 수 있습니다.
예를 들어, 고객 테이블과 주문 테이블을 고객 ID를 기준으로 조인하여 각 고객의 모든 주문을 추출할 수 있습니다. 그런 다음 VLOOKUP 함수를 사용하여 특정 고객 ID에 대한 주문 정보를 찾을 수 있습니다.
Q: 조인 연산을 사용할 때 고려해야 할 사항은 무엇입니까?
A: * 서로 다른 테이블의 공통 키가 고유하고 정확해야 합니다. * 조인 연산은 데이터베이스 성능에 영향을 미칠 수 있으므로 필요한 데이터만 조인하도록 조심하세요. * 여러 테이블을 조인할 때 조인 순서가 결과에 영향을 줄 수 있습니다.
Power Query를 활용한 고급 데이터 변환 자동화
VLOOKUP 함수는 간편한 데이터 변환에 유용하지만 보다 복잡한 작업에는 한계가 있습니다. Power Query를 사용하면 더욱 고급화된 데이터 변환 작업을 자동화할 수 있습니다. Power Query를 활용한 단계별 지침은 다음과 같습니다.
- Power Query 편집기 열기: Excel에서 '데이터' 탭으로 이동하고 '데이터 가져오기' 그룹에서 '기타 소스' > '공백 쿼리'를 선택합니다.
- 데이터 연결: 변환할 데이터가 있는 워크시트 또는 외부 데이터 소스를 연결합니다.
- 데이터 수정: Power Query의 '변환' 탭을 사용하여 데이터를 정렬, 필터링, 그룹화, 피벗하여 필요한 형태로 변환합니다.
- 고급 변환: '추가 열' 또는 '분할 열' 옵션을 사용하여 고급 논리적 절차를 추가합니다. 필요에 따라 사용자 지정 함수를 작성할 수도 있습니다.
- 데이터 형식 변경: '데이터 유형 변경' 기능을 사용하여 값이 숫자, 텍스트 또는 기타 데이터 유형으로 올바르게 형식화되었는지 확인합니다.
- 쿼리 병합 및 결합: '병합' 또는 '결합' 기능을 사용하여 다른 쿼리 또는 테이블의 데이터를 병합하여 포함적 결과를 만듭니다.
- 결과 표시: '닫기 및 로드' 옵션을 사용하여 변환된 데이터를 새 워크시트 또는 기존 테이블로 보냅니다.
VLOOKUP을 통한 대규모 데이터세트 처리 최적화
blockquote
"VLOOKUP이 불규칙적이거나 반복적인 데이터 추출 작업을 최적화하는 데 매우 유용한 것으로 나타났습니다. 이 함수는 대규모 데이터세트를 처리할 때 전반적인 프로세스 시간과 노력을 대폭 절약할 수 있습니다." - 마이크로소프트 엑셀 전문가, 제인 도
대규모 데이터세트를 다룰 경우 VLOOKUP 함수를 활용하면 데이터 추출과 업데이트 작업 시간을 상당히 단축할 수 있습니다.
- 효율성 향상: VLOOKUP은 분류된 데이터를 검색하고 대규모 데이터세트에서 일치하는 항목을 빠르게 반환합니다. 이를 통해 수동 검색의 필요성을 없애고 프로세스 시간을 단축합니다.
- 인적 오류 최소화: 반복적인 수동 작업을 자동화하면 데이터베이스 오류, 필기 오류 또는 숫자 입력 오류와 같은 인적 오류 발생 가능성이 줄어듭니다.
- 데이터 관리 최적화: VLOOKUP을 사용하면 데이터를 일관되게 중앙화하고 업데이트하여 데이터 정합성과 신뢰성을 향상시킬 수 있습니다.
- 핵심 데이터에 집중: 업무 자동화를 통해 반복적인 데이터 추출 작업으로 인한 시간 낭비를 줄일 수 있으므로 사용자는 더 복잡한 분석이나 의사 결정에 집중할 수 있는 여유를 얻습니다.
정리하자면, 대규모 데이터세트 처리를 위해 VLOOKUP 함수를 통합하는 것은 반복적인 업무를 자동화하여 효율성을 향상시키고, 정확도를 높이며, 데이터 관리를 최적화하는 데 필수적인 요소입니다.
이야기의 시작, 요약으로 먼저 만나보세요 🌈
VLOOKUP 함수를 사용하여 반복 작업을 자동화하면 엄청난 시간과 노력을 절약할 수 있습니다. 이 강력한 도구를 활용하면 데이터 수집, 분석, 보고 작업을 더욱 효율적으로 수행할 수 있습니다.
데이터 작업에 종사하는 모든 전문가에게 VLOOKUP 함수를 마스터하는 것은 필수적인 것입니다. 이 함수를 사용하면 업무 시간을 절약할 뿐만 아니라 데이터 관리 과정을 현대화하여 스스로 더 많은 시간을 할애할 수 있습니다.
오늘날의 디지털 시대에는 반복적이고 시끌벅적한 작업을 자동화하는 것이 업계의 기대치가 되어 가고 있습니다. VLOOKUP 함수를 자신의 도구 키트에 추가하면, 업무 생산성 향상과 경력 발전으로 이어질 비약을 할 수 있습니다.
다음에 반복 작업에 갇혀 있을 때는 VLOOKUP 함수를 고려해 보세요. 데이터 탐진, 분석, 관리를 자동화하여 더 창의적이고 가치 있는 업무에 몰두할 수 있도록 해 줍니다.
댓글